Users often buy these peels to treat hyperpigmentation , fine lines , acne scars , and uneven skin texture .

Unlike many other acids, lactic acid acts as a natural humectant, meaning it helps the skin retain moisture while exfoliating.

These very high concentrations (often with low pH levels around 0.4) are typically intended for clinical settings or highly experienced users.

Lactic acid peels are popular alpha-hydroxy acid (AHA) treatments designed to dissolve the "glue" holding dead skin cells together, revealing a brighter and smoother complexion underneath. Because lactic acid is a larger molecule than other acids like glycolic, it penetrates the skin more slowly, making it one of the gentlest chemical exfoliants available.
